Expression

Organism Comment Expression
Chlamydomonas reinhardtii isoform Hpt1 is strongly regulated by dark and low-temperature. Under the same treatments, alpha-tocopherol increases in cultures exposed to darkness or heat, whereas gamma-tocopherol does it in low temperature additional information
